Career Advancement Programme in Sustainable Habitat Practices for Golf Courses
-- ViewingNowThe Career Advancement Programme in Sustainable Habitat Practices for Golf Courses is a certificate course designed to empower greenkeepers, golf course superintendents, and environmental managers with the skills needed to create sustainable habitats. This programme emphasizes the importance of balancing golf course maintenance with environmental stewardship, a critical concern for the industry.

The Career Advancement Programme in Sustainable Habitat Practices for Golf Courses is designed to equip learners with the skills needed to become leading professionals in sustainable golf course management.
This 3D pie chart showcases the job market trends and skill demand in the UK for various roles in this field.
Roles in sustainable golf course design, eco-friendly turf management, water management, renewable energy solutions, and waste management are all essential components of a sustainable golf course.
A Sustainable Golf Course Designer (30%) is responsible for planning and implementing sustainable design features, while an Eco-friendly Turf Management Specialist (25%) focuses on maintaining the turf using environmentally friendly practices.
Water Management Consultants (20%) ensure the efficient use of water resources for irrigation, while Renewable Energy Solutions Engineers (15%) help reduce the carbon footprint of golf courses by implementing renewable energy systems.
Finally, Waste Management Coordinators (10%) are in charge of reducing, reusing, and recycling waste materials generated at the golf course.
By offering a comprehensive understanding of these roles, the Career Advancement Programme in Sustainable Habitat Practices for Golf Courses prepares learners for a successful and impactful career in the golf industry.
